Subject: gnats/emacs problem

Hi, I contacted Mr. Milan Zamazal (whose name is noted on the gnats.el
file) but he noted that "I don't maintain nor use GNATS for several
years" and so I'm a bit stuck.  Here is my problem - I seem to be
having problems with emacs/gnats' "edit-pr".  After making changes to
my PR, I C-c C-c yet nothing happens and I get a,

  ''Input timeout from the server''

displayed in the message area.

Using,
 emacs-21.3.1
 gnats-4.0-2
 gnats.el (no version noted, 'Copyright (C) 2000, 2001, 2002 Milan Zamazal')
 Linux bozo/debian 2.4.22 #2 Thu Sep 18 20:47:45 PDT 2003 i686 GNU/Linux

I believe its due to gnats waiting to get a reply from me with regard
to what it is that I changed since I see "send the field change reason"
in the 'gnats-show-connection' buffer.

  212 Ok, send field text now.
  analyzed
  .
  210 Ok.
  REPL 7 State
  212 Ok.
  analyzed
  .
  213 Ok, now send the field change reason.
  LOCK 7 emacs

But I'm never prompted for what it is that I changed and thus the
problem (I'm guessing).  Any other ideas ?

Do please let me know if I'm doing something wrong and how to fix this
problem.  If there is a more updated version of gnats.el (or a patch)
do please let me know - I wasn't able to find one.
